MTSU hosts Georgia State on Saturday, Bellarmine on Sunday
1/27/2023 11:00:00 AM | Women's Tennis
MURFREESBORO, Tenn. — After a thrilling victory against Austin Peay, Middle Tennessee women's tennis hosts Georgia State on Saturday, Jan. 28 at 1 p.m. and Bellarmine on Sunday, Jan. 29 at 11 a.m.
The Blue Raiders are coming off their first win of the season, which came on Jan. 22 against Austin Peay at the Adams Tennis Complex. The match started off with a doubles win from Love-Star Alexis and Rutuja Chaphalkar. MTSU secured the doubles point with a 6-3 victory from Sana Garakani and Noelle Mauro.
In singles, Mauro followed her doubles win with a dominating 6-2, 6-0 win to give the Blue Raiders a 2-0 lead. The Governors took a point on court No. 3. Alexis gave MTSU the third point of the day with a 6-3, 6-3 victory on court No. 1. Austin Peay won on courts No. 2 and 6 to tie it at three all. The match would be decided on court No. 4.
Lilly-Sophie Schmidt fell in the first set 5-7. Schmidt would fight back to win the second set 6-3. The third set would go to a tiebreak. The junior from Schriesheim, Germany started the tiebreak down 3-5. Schmidt won the next four points to secure the match win for the Blue Raiders.
Match Four: Georgia State (0-1, 0-0 SBC) vs. Middle Tennessee (1-2, 0-0 C-USA)
- Saturday, Jan. 28 – 1 p.m. CT
- Adams Tennis Complex
- Murfreesboro, Tenn.
All-time vs. Georgia State
- Saturday's matchup will be the ninth meeting between the two programs. The Blue Raiders lead the series 7-1.
- The Blue Raiders are 3-0 against the Panthers at home.
- Coach Bailey-Duvall is 1-0 against GSU.
Scouting the Panthers
- Georgia State return five players from last year's squad. The returners combined for 32 singles wins. In doubles, the team in 2022 combined for 33 wins.
- Chivu, the No. 1 court, and Stanescu, the No. 3 court, return for the Panthers.
Match Five: Bellarmine (1-4, 0-0 ASUN) vs. Middle Tennessee (1-2, 0-0 C-USA)
- Sunday, Jan. 29 – 11 a.m. CT
- Adams Tennis Complex
- Murfreesboro, Tenn.
All-time vs. Bellarmine
- First meeting between the two programs.
Scouting the Knights
- Bellarmine return two players from 2022.
- The Knights welcome five freshman to this year's team.
